    Bio + Chronology . NOAH PURIFOY 1917 - 2004. Born in Snow Hill, Alabama August 17, 1917; died in Joshua Tree, California March 9, 2004. 1989-2004 Outdoor Desert Art Museum of Assemblage Sculpture created in the high desert of Joshua Tree, California, More than 100 works of art created and placed on 10 acres of the desert floor and in a gallery structure,
